Forgotten Attachment Detector now supports Arabic, German and Japanese
It’s been quite a while since we released the Forgotten Attachment Detector (FAD) outlook add-in. We have been closely listening to your feedback and suggestions and have managed to gather significant data as a result. Thank you all for your valuable input!
One of the most requested features for FAD was to support languages other than English. In fact, our data indicated that users already figured out a way of using FAD for other languages by adding keywords specific to those languages in the keyword list. Unfortunately, FAD was not set up to be used this way and resulted in more false positives.
Today I am excited to announce a new release of FAD that supports three additional languages – Arabic, German and Japanese. I have chosen these three languages for the unique and diverse challenges they present in localization, obviating the need to support any additional languages. Along with localization support, this release contains several performance enhancements and a few bug fixes. Get the new version here.
